Stalins Organ Posted July 4, 2010 Share Posted July 4, 2010 Passenger seats (or accomodations....) are required to withstand a 16g deceleration - if yuo can design a hammock that'll do that go for it! Seiously tho - survival chances are much better if passengers face backwards so that any deceleration load can be spread across their entire back rather than jsut across a seat belt....but airlines refuse to do so because such seats taking greater loads require stronger frames to support them (not much use having a strong seat if it rips out of the floor!), which increases weight & lowers the payload they can carry - ie fewer passengers. I've always heard that the airlines resisted because they claimed passengers wouldn't go for it, which was never very convincing. The weight/payload tradeoff is much more credible. Except, surely (don't call me Shirley!) the total load is the same regardless of facing, so I don't quite see why a rear facing seat would have to be more robust/heavier. Hmm. I suppose that in a forward-facing seat, pivoting around the seatbelt would transfer some portion of the passenger's weight through their legs and feet directly down onto the floor - probably quite a large portion when in the brace position - and only the seatbelt securing points would have to be especially strong. In a rear facing seat all of the passenger's weight/momentum would have to be supported by the chair alone, and the whole upright piece would have to be reasonably strong. Also, in forward-facing the chair would have to be strong in tension, while in rear-facing it'd have to be stronmg in compression, if that makes any difference. 0 Quote Link to comment Share on other sites More sharing options...

Stalins Organ Posted July 5, 2010 Share Posted July 5, 2010 Therreason for more weight with rearward facing seats is that the passengers can stand a higher loading, so regulatory authorities (and the public) are almost guaranteed to insist that the seats be capable of withstaning that higher loading - hence stronger seats, stronger mounts, and stronger structure supporting it all - and stronger = heavier. 0 Quote Link to comment Share on other sites More sharing options...
